CISA Resources to Reduce Ransomware Risk

The total number of ransomware attacks quintupled globally over the last two years and are expected to rise 20 to 40 percent this year.

In response, the Cybersecurity and Infrastructure Security Agency (CISA) is promoting no-cost resources to help you keep your organization secure.

Join Amy Nicewick, CISA Section Chief of Communication Management and David Stern, CISA SLTT Partnership Lead, as they discuss:

  • The state of the ransomware threatscape
  • Best practices in ransomware prevention
  • Free tools and resources CISA provides to help you reduce your risk
